Intelligent monitoring control system and method for port precast pile sinking construction
The invention provides an intelligent monitoring control system and method for port precast pile sinking construction, and belongs to the field of port wharf pile foundation construction. The system comprises six modules and a terminal display; in the six modules, a Beidou satellite measurement positioning module is used for guiding a pile driving barge to be in place and adjusting the posture; a data acquisition module is used for acquiring pile sinking construction monitoring data; a data transmission module is used for transmitting data of the data acquisition module and a data processing module; the data processing module is used for analyzing and processing the pile sinking construction monitoring data; a data storage module is used for storing the pile sinking construction monitoring data; an early warning module is used for receiving early warning information sent by the data processing module and carrying out voice prompt; and the terminal display is used for displaying curve changes and the early warning information in the construction process in real time. The system and method are used for intelligent monitoring control of port precast pile sinking construction, and have the characteristics of being high in measurement precision, capable of stably running for a long time and capable of achieving intelligent reference correction.
